What is Icape Holding EV-to-OCF?

Icape Holding XPAR:ALICA -1.40% 77 EV-to-OCF is 12.52 as of Sep. 11, 2026, which is 8% below its 10-year median of 13.64. GuruFocus rates XPAR:ALICA with a GF Score™ of 77/100 and a GF Value™ of €11.62 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 7 warning signs investors should review. Among 2,492 Hardware companies, Icape Holding ranks worse than 58.63% on this metric.

EV-to-OC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its cash flow from operations. As of today, Icape Holding's Enterprise Value is €101.4 Mil. Icape Holding's Cash Flow from Operations for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was €8.1 Mil. Therefore, Icape Holding's EV-to-OCF for today is 12.52.

Enterprise Value is used because it is a more complete measure in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. Cash Flow from Operations is an important financial metric because it represents the cash generated from operating activities at a company's disposal. Companies with a low EV-to-OCF ratio, combined with a strong balance sheet are generally considered as undervalued.

Icape Holding Business Description

Other Exchanges Z8J:Germany
Address Immeuble Volta 33 Avenue du General Leclerc, Fontenay-aux-Roses, FRA, 92260
Icape Holding SA is engaged in the distribution, trade, and production of printed circuit boards (PCB), which are essential components used across the electronics industry, including the business, telecommunications, automotive, connected objects, home automation, e-mobility, medical, power, multimedia, and IT industries. Its segemnts are: It operates through the Trade in printed circuit boards (PCB) - Americas; Trade and production of printed circuit boards (PCB); Trade and production of printed circuit boards (PCB) - Central Europe; Trade in printed circuit boards (PCB) - Asia and the Rest of the World, which generates maximum revenue; Trade and production of technical parts (Tech Parts) - Europe; and Trade and production of technical parts (Tech Parts) - Rest of the World.
